摘要
Mitochondrial antiviral-signaling protein (MAVS) transmits signals from RIG-I-like receptors after RNA virus infections. However, the mechanism by which MAVS activates downstream components, such as TBK1 and IKK alpha/beta, is unclear, although previous work suggests the involvement of NEMO or TBK1-binding proteins TANK, NAP1, and SINTBAD. Here, we report that MAVS-mediated innate immune activation is dependent on TRAFs, partially on NEMO, but not on TBK1-binding proteins. MAVS recruited TBK1/IKK epsilon by TRAFs that were pre-associated with TBK1/IKK epsilon via direct interaction between the coiled-coil domain of TRAFs and the SDD domain of TBK1/IKK epsilon. TRAF(2-/-)3(-/-)5(-/-)6(-/-) cells completely lost RNA virus responses. TRAFs' E3 ligase activity was required for NEMO activation by synthesizing ubiquitin chains that bound to NEMO for NF-kappa B and TBK1/IKK epsilon activation. NEMO-activated IKK alpha/beta were important for TBK1/IKK epsilon activation through IKK alpha/beta-mediated TBK1/IKK epsilon phosphorylation. Moreover, individual TRAFs differently mediated TBK1/IKK epsilon activation and thus fine-tuned antiviral immunity under physiological conditions.
